Energy Savings of Warehouse Lighting in LED
Switching to LED lighting in warehouses can result in significant energy savings. The following table outlines different types of warehouse lighting fixtures, their applications, typical mounting heights, and the energy savings percentage achieved by upgrading to LED.
Lighting Fixture | Application | Typical Mounting Height | Energy Savings (%) |
---|---|---|---|
High Bay Lights | Large open areas | 15-40 feet | 60% |
Low Bay Lights | Smaller spaces | 12-20 feet | 50% |
Linear Strip Lights | Aisles and corridors | 8-15 feet | 55% |
Flood Lights | Outdoor areas | Variable | 65% |
By upgrading to LED lighting, warehouses in Kentwood can significantly reduce their energy consumption, leading to lower utility bills and a smaller carbon footprint. The initial investment in LED technology is often offset by these long-term savings, making it a financially sound decision for many businesses.
Every Warehouse in Kentwood town, Louisiana is Different
Understanding the existing lighting setup in a warehouse is essential before making the switch to LED. Each warehouse in Kentwood town is unique, with varying dimensions, operations, and lighting requirements. To begin, it’s important to identify the types and models of the current lighting fixtures, including their wattage and input voltage. This information helps in selecting the appropriate LED replacements that will provide optimal illumination while maximizing energy efficiency.
The dimensions of the warehouse facility also play a crucial role in determining the lighting needs. Larger spaces may require high bay lights, while smaller areas might benefit from low bay or linear strip lights. Additionally, understanding the major operations within the warehouse, such as storage, assembly, or shipping, can influence the choice of lighting fixtures. For instance, areas with high activity levels may require brighter lighting to ensure safety and productivity.
Other Considerations for Kentwood town, Louisiana
When selecting LED lighting fixtures for warehouses in Kentwood, it’s important to consider local climate-specific conditions. The town’s climate can affect the performance and longevity of lighting fixtures, making it essential to choose products that can withstand temperature fluctuations and humidity levels. Additionally, local codes or utility rebates may require the implementation of lighting controls, such as daylight sensors or motion sensor controls.
These lighting controls offer several benefits, including further energy savings and enhanced convenience. Daylight sensors adjust the lighting levels based on natural light availability, reducing energy consumption during daylight hours. Motion sensor controls ensure that lights are only active when needed, minimizing unnecessary energy use. By incorporating these controls, warehouses can optimize their lighting systems for both efficiency and functionality.
